NASA Satellite Crashes to Earth Today with Low Impact Risk

A massive 600kg NASA satellite, the Van Allen Probe A, is set to re-enter Earth's atmosphere today. The US space agency estimates a 1 in 4,200 chance of debris hitting anyone, with most components expected to burn up during descent.
